Output 89a82d1119c7055c6db270cae82085b49d9835e9a699ec46ae9596406699931a:0

value
734353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aa37b2c742fa93ff71624caf77df8ac09ae3a16 OP_EQUAL
address
3FnfpxLSP1W9EyTtoGt1HA5RbVhU2GktHH
transaction
89a82d1119c7055c6db270cae82085b49d9835e9a699ec46ae9596406699931a
spent
true